“…Among them, the strains ATMLC92021 and ATMLC152021 were closely related to Bacillus subtilis . In previous studies, some strains of this species have been reported to improve the drought tolerance in sugarcane, fenugreek, and wheat [ 26 , 27 , 28 ]. In addition, the strain ATMLC102021 was closely related to B. tequilensis clade; this species was described as osmotic stress-tolerant and presented with the capacity to improve drought stress tolerance in maize, wheat, and eggplant [ 29 , 30 ].…”

“…Plant growth-promoting rhizobacteria which possess the enzyme 1-aminocyclopropane-1-carboxylate (ACC) deaminase facilitate plant growth and development by decreasing ethylene levels, inducing a reduction in drought stress in plants [ 51 ]. The production of key traits for PGPR strains was found among many representatives of the bacteria used in this work and they were also tested in the context of drought [ 52 , 53 , 54 , 55 ].…”

“…Additionally, (Verma et al, 2021) found that the endophytic Streptomyces geysiriensis strain produces IAA and GA3 which stimulate indigenous levels of plant hormones; thus, endophytes modulate developmental or signaling processes in plants. Moreover, numerous mechanisms of action for Streptomyces have been identified, including assisting plants in acquiring nutrients, creating growth regulators including (SA) and proline (Pro), and reducing levels of the stress hormone ethylene (Kour et al, 2022). With the current advancement in microbial ecology, endophytic Streptomyces are gaining popularity.…”
